    3.- Academic Fresh Start
    (Texas Education Code, Section 51.931)

    Undergraduate Programs: An applicant for undergraduate admission who is a Texas resident may elect to enter this institution pursuant to the Academic Fresh Start statute, Texas Education Code, § 51.931. When the applicant informs the admissions office in writing of the election, the institution will not consider in the admissions decision any academic course credits or grades earned by the applicant 10 or more years prior to the starting date of the semester in which the applicant seeks to enroll. An applicant who elects to apply under this statute may not receive any course credit for courses taken 10 or more years prior to enrollment under Academic Fresh Start.

    Postgraduate/Professional Programs: An applicant who has earned a baccalaureate degree under the Academic Fresh Start statute, Texas Education Code, § 51.931, and applies for admission to a postgraduate or professional program will be evaluated on only the grade point average of the course work completed for that baccalaureate degree and the other criteria stated herein for admission to the postgraduate or professional program.
